How much do electronics engineer j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 20, 2026, the average yearly pay for electronics engineer in Spokane, WA is $89,885.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$60,200.00 and $110,700.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does an electronics engineer do?

An electronics engineer designs, develops, and tests electronic equipment such as circuit boards, communication systems, and control devices. They work on products ranging from small consumer gadgets to large industrial machines. Their responsibilities often include creating schematics, troubleshooting hardware issues, and ensuring products comply with safety and quality standards. Electronics engineers may also work on improving existing devices or developing cutting-edge technologies.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an electronics engineer,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Electronics Engineer, you need a strong background in circuit design, signal processing, and electronics theory, typically supported by a bachelor's degree in electrical or electronics engineering. Familiarity with design software such as MATLAB, Altium Designer, and simulation tools, along with relevant certifications like Professional Engineer (PE), is often required. Analytical thinking, problem-solving, and effective communication are vital soft skills for collaborating and troubleshooting complex issues. These skills ensure precise development, efficient teamwork, and successful implementation of innovative electronic systems.

What are some common challenges electronics engineers face when working on multidisciplinary teams?

Electronics Engineers often collaborate with professionals in software, mechanical, and manufacturing disciplines, which can present challenges in aligning different technical languages and priorities. Effective communication and a willingness to adapt are crucial, as project requirements may change based on input from team members with different expertise. To succeed, Electronics Engineers should cultivate strong collaboration skills and proactively seek clarification to ensure all components integrate seamlessly. This cross-functional teamwork is also a valuable opportunity to broaden your understanding of how electronics fit into larger systems.

What is the difference between Electronics Engineer vs Electrical Engineer?

AspectElectronics EngineerElectrical Engineer
Required CredentialsBachelor's degree in Electronics Engineering or related field; certifications like Cisco or IPC may be beneficialBachelor's degree in Electrical Engineering; similar certifications may apply
Work EnvironmentDesigning and testing electronic circuits, working in labs, manufacturing plants, or officesWorking with electrical systems, power distribution, and large-scale electrical infrastructure
Industry UsageConsumer electronics, telecommunications, embedded systemsPower generation, electrical utilities, industrial machinery

Electronics Engineers focus on designing and developing electronic devices and systems, while Electrical Engineers work on larger electrical systems and power infrastructure. Both roles require similar educational backgrounds but differ in their specific applications and work environments.

Job description

Electronic Design Engineer

Our client in the Spokane, WA location is currently hiring for an Electronic Design Engineer. This position is an onsite opportunity within a collaborative manufacturing environment, supporting the development of innovative embedded and electronic products. The ideal candidate will have experience in embedded systems, electronic hardware design, firmware development, and product development from concept through production.

Pay - $37.50 - $50.00/hour (Depending on years of experience, embedded systems experience, PCB design experience, programming proficiency, and relevant industry experience)

Location - Spokane, WA (Onsite)

Schedule - Standard Monday-Friday (40 hours per week)

Contract Type - Contract-to-Hire (12 Months)

Responsibilities

• Design and develop electronic circuits for embedded and computer-related products.

• Develop, test, and maintain embedded firmware for microprocessor-based systems.

• Collaborate with customers to define product requirements and technical specifications.

• Build, troubleshoot, and refine prototypes throughout the product development lifecycle.

• Support product testing, validation procedures, and development of test equipment.

• Assist with proof-of-concept models and product demonstration units.

• Develop manufacturing quality standards and product specifications.

• Utilize circuit simulation, schematic capture, and PCB design tools to create and evaluate designs.

• Lead or support engineering projects from concept through production release.

• Partner with manufacturing and quality teams to support successful product launches.

• Contribute to continuous improvement initiatives focused on product performance, reliability, and manufacturability.

• Apply Design of Experiments (DOE) methodologies to support product development and optimization efforts.

Qualification Requirements

• 2-5 years of experience in electronic engineering, embedded systems, or hardware design.

• Hands-on experience developing embedded systems and microprocessor-based products.

• Electronic hardware design experience including circuit design, troubleshooting, and analysis.

• Programming experience utilizing Embedded C and C++.

• Experience with PCB design, schematic capture, and circuit layout tools.

• Experience utilizing circuit simulation software.

• Experience developing, testing, and validating electronic products.

• Experience supporting products from concept through production.

• Ability to work closely with customers, engineering teams, manufacturing teams, and quality personnel.

• Strong problem-solving and troubleshooting skills.
